How To Talk To Your Child About Inappropriate Touching

It can be difficult to know how to talk to your child about inappropriate touching. You want to be sure to communicate the seriousness of the situation, while also maintaining a supportive and reassuring tone. Here are a few tips on how to have that conversation.

First, you’ll want to make sure that your child understands what inappropriate touching is. Explain that it’s any kind of touching that makes them feel uncomfortable, whether it’s from a stranger or someone they know. It’s important to be clear and specific, so your child knows what to watch out for.

Next, you’ll want to talk about what to do if someone inappropriate touches them. Tell your child that they should always tell you or another trusted adult immediately. It’s important to make sure your child knows that they are not responsible for the situation, and that they did nothing wrong.

Finally, you’ll want to reassure your child that they are safe. Let them know that you will do everything you can to keep them safe, and that you will help them deal with the situation. It’s important to be supportive and understanding during this difficult time.

Talking to your child about inappropriate touching can be difficult, but it’s important to ensure their safety. By using these tips, you can help your child feel supported and safe.

Should we talk with children for inappropriate touch?

It’s natural for parents to worry about their children, and one of the things that can cause parents to worry is when their child experiences or is told about inappropriate touch. Parents may wonder if they should talk to their child about inappropriate touch, and if so, what they should say.

Experts agree that it is important for parents to talk to their children about inappropriate touch. One reason for this is that children may not know what to do if someone touches them in a way that makes them uncomfortable. It is important for children to understand that they should tell a trusted adult if this happens to them.

parents should talk to their children about inappropriate touch in a way that is developmentally appropriate for their age. For very young children, parents can simply explain that some people may touch them in a way that makes them feel uncomfortable, and they should tell a trusted adult if this happens. For older children, parents can talk about specific types of touch that may be inappropriate, such as touching someone’s genitals or bottom.

It is also important for parents to be aware of their own feelings about inappropriate touch. If parents have been affected by inappropriate touch in the past, it may be difficult for them to talk to their children about it. In these cases, it may be helpful to seek out professional help in order to provide the best possible support for their child.

What is considered inappropriate touching of a child?

Inappropriate touching of a child can be defined as any touch that is unwanted or makes the child feel uncomfortable. This can include touching the child’s body in a sexual way, touching the child’s private parts, or any other unwanted physical contact.

It is important to be aware of what constitutes inappropriate touching of a child, so that you can protect your child from sexual abuse or other forms of physical abuse. It is also important to be aware of what to do if you suspect that your child has been inappropriately touched.

If you think that your child has been touched in a way that makes them uncomfortable, it is important to talk to them about it. You can explain that the touch was not okay, and that they should tell you if anyone ever touches them in that way again. It is also important to tell your child that they can tell anyone else about the touch, including a teacher, a relative, or a friend.

If you suspect that your child has been sexually abused, it is important to seek help from a professional. You can call the police or child protective services to report the abuse. It is also important to get your child evaluated by a doctor, to make sure that they are not harmed physically or emotionally.
